The Somatosensory System: Your Body’s Pain Radar
The somatosensory system plays a pivotal role in how we experience pain. It comprises sensory receptors that respond to touch, temperature, and pain, sending signals to the spinal cord and brain for interpretation. The distribution of these receptors influences sensitivity: areas with more dense receptor networks, like fingertips, are more sensitive to pain when injured. Conversely, larger body areas with fewer receptors heal more slowly due to reduced inflammatory responses.
Managing Pain Through Cognitive Mechanisms
One of the striking findings discussed by Huberman is the mind’s power over our experience of pain. For example, cognitive distractions, like visualizing loved ones, can diminish pain perception. This top-down modulation shows that our feelings and mental state significantly impact how we process and react to pain, highlighting how psychological aspects intertwine with physiological responses. Anticipating pain relief—like the effect posed by expecting morphine—can also mitigate the perceived intensity of pain.

Strategies for Recovery from Injury
For effective recovery from injuries, a multi-faceted approach is recommended. Huberman emphasizes adequate sleep—aiming for eight hours—as a critical component. Sleep activates the glymphatic system, vital for clearing debris and promoting healing. Beyond just rest, engaging in mild exercise can facilitate recovery without stressing the injured area and improve circulation.
Understanding Inflammation and Its Role in Healing
Huberman also sheds light on inflammation—essential for healing versus chronic inflammation, which can be detrimental. Recognizing how inflammation functions post-injury allows individuals to appreciate its integral role in the healing process. For instance, inflammation recruits necessary cells to the injury site, aiding in recovery. Thus, moderation is essential; acute inflammation is beneficial, while chronic inflammation must be managed.
